Paraguay is one of the few countries in Latin America that has positive economic data and a stable economy and democracy, despite large, crisis-ridden neighbors such as Argentina and Brazil. The country's growth has been financially stable for years - reason enough to take a closer look at Paraguay when making an investment decision in Latin America.

Paraguay also has an excellent investment climate. It offers numerous investment incentives with high tax benefits, and profits can be freely transferred abroad. Of particular interest to manufacturing companies are the very competitive energy and labor costs. As over 99% of the energy is generated by hydropower, this is also an attractive location from an environmental point of view. Labor costs are up to 50% lower than in Brazil, which has a large labor force, and energy costs are about 60% lower. With a corporate tax rate of only 10%, Paraguay is an exiting opportunity.

Teicher, Kerstin
Born in Berlin in 1967, Dr. Kerstin Teicher studied business administration and Japanese studies in Berlin, Tokyo and Kassel. For more than 20 years she has held responsible positions in the German economy and has traveled extensively in Japan, Latin America, and Europe. Her career has also included strategic positions in the media industry and management consulting. She regularly writes, lectures, and teaches on a variety of business topics, mostly from a comparative perspective. As a result, she has long been a household name among practitioners and academics. She takes on new and critical topics, but packages them in an easily understandable and varied way for her readers.

She has known Paraguay since 2005 and has carried out numerous business and political projects, taught business administration at the German Paraguayan University (UPA) and writes about Paraguayan and Latin American business, politics and culture as a journalist for the monthly German language magazine "Die Zeitung".
